Delaware Statutes

§ 6821 — Definitions

Delaware·Title 16·Part Safety·Ch. 68 EXEMPTIONS FROM CIVIL LIABILITY·Subch. Immunity for Donated Food

For purposes of this subchapter:

(1)“Food” means any raw, cooked, processed, or prepared edible substance, ice, beverage, or ingredient used or intended to be used in whole or part for human consumption that is apparently fit for human consumption. “Food” includes nonperishable food, perishable food, and wild game.
(2)“Gleaner” means a person who gleans an agricultural crop that has been donated by the owner of the agricultural crop.
(3)“Gleans” or “gleaned” means to gather an agricultural crop leftover after a harvest.
(4)“Nonperishable food” means any food that has been commercially processed, prepared, and packaged for human consumption and that is intended to remain fit for human consumption without refrigeration for a reasonable length of time.
